Description

Court Cottage and Manor Cottage are a pair of houses believed to date from the late 16th century or 17th century, although they have been altered and restored. The buildings are constructed of rubble and feature a double Roman tiled roof with coped raised verges. They are two storeys high with attics that have modern gabled dormers. The ground floor has modern windows, while the first floor is fitted with 2-light casements set in chamfered surrounds. Court Cottage has a plank door with a chamfered surround and a segmental lintel, while Manor Cottage has a modern door.
